Description

Hedge End Town Council are looking to resurface the paddling pool ahead of the 2023 season which begins in May. The existing facility is extremely popular, so it is crucial that these works are completed ahead of the May opening. Site Description The paddling pool was originally installed by Sunsafe in 2001 and has been resurfaced twice since in 2007 and 2014. The pool is located on the southern end of St. Johns Recreation Ground. Access is through a gate on the northern boundary leading directly from a tarmac car park. There is no formal road to the site, but the field can be safely traversed during late spring/ summer providing it has not been too wet. The existing pool wetpour surfacing is approximately 300m2 in total, including the areas below the water level, the area above water level and the area directly outside the main pool that edges the perimeter drains. Tender brief Provide options and prices to resurface the paddling pool wetpour surfacing. Quotes must include removal and disposal of the existing surface. Option 1 - To remove existing surfacing (Areas A, B & C on map above) and to supply and lay a total of (approximately) 300m² of 20mm depth EN1177 certified wetpour rubber surfacing. The design will consist of 3 'splash' shapes around the water features, a splash shape within the pool itself and a change in colour between the area in the water and the shoreline (Beach) in a mix of 3 colours - yellow, aquamarine blue and a dark blue. Option 2 - To remove existing surfacing in areas 'A' and 'B' and to supply and lay a total of (approximately) 225m² of 20mm depth EN1177 certified wetpour rubber surfacing. The design will consist of 3 'splash' shapes around the water features, a splash shape within the pool itself and a change in colour between the area in the water and the shoreline (Beach) in a mix of 3 colours yellow, aquamarine blue and a dark blue. In addition, area 'C' requires repair at the join between the wetpour and the drains which is approximately 45m in length. Option 3 - To remove existing surfacing in the blue (A) area only and to supply and lay a total of (approximately) 125m² of 20mm depth EN1177 certified wetpour rubber surfacing. The design will be similar to the existing in aquamarine blue and a dark blue 'splash' shape in the centre of the pool. In addition, area 'C' requires repair were the wetpour joins the drains which is approximately 45m in length. Additional - We would be interested to see example designs, motifs etc of previous projects as well as an indication of costs that could add interest to the site. Prices All prices are to be net, excluding VAT.
